Which pesticide product is made by adhering active ingredients to a solid carrier such as talc, clay, or silica?

A) Solutions (S)

B) Concentrate Solutions (C, LC, or WSC/WSL)

C) Dry Pesticide Products

Dry pesticide products are made by binding active ingredients to a solid carrier such as talc, clay, or silica. Solutions (A) are liquid formulations of pesticides and do not contain a solid carrier. Concentrate solutions (B) also do not contain a solid carrier and are concentrated forms of liquid pesticides that need to be mixed with water before use. Emulsifiable Concentrate (D) is a type of liquid pesticide that contains oils and emulsifiers, but not a solid carrier. Therefore, the best answer is C - Dry Pesticide Products.
